Maintaining a drought-resistant lawn in Rochester requires specific practices to ensure its health and longevity. First, water the lawn deeply but infrequently to encourage deep root growth; this will help the grass withstand dry periods. It's essential to mow at a higher setting, as taller grass shades the soil and reduces evaporation. Additionally, consider applying a layer of mulch to retain moisture and suppress weeds. Fertilizing with organic products can also promote healthy growth without encouraging excessive water needs. Regularly inspect your lawn for pests or diseases and consult with local landscaping professionals for tailored maintenance tips that suit Rochester's climate and conditions.
Preparing your yard for drought-resistant lawn installation in Rochester involves several key steps. First, assess your current soil condition; it may be beneficial to conduct a soil test to check pH levels and nutrient content. This information will help you determine if amendments are necessary. Next, clear the area of any existing grass, weeds, or debris to provide a clean slate for your new lawn. Tilling the soil may also be necessary to improve aeration and drainage. Finally, consider consulting with local landscaping professionals who can provide tailored advice and ensure your yard is properly prepared for the installation of drought-resistant grasses that thrive in Rochester's climate.

A drought-resistant lawn is designed to withstand dry conditions and require less water than traditional grass types. In Rochester, where weather patterns can fluctuate, installing a drought-resistant lawn can be a smart choice for homeowners looking to conserve water and reduce maintenance efforts. These lawns typically consist of native grasses and plants that thrive in the local climate, making them more resilient to drought conditions. Additionally, a drought-resistant lawn can help reduce your water bill and contribute to environmental conservation efforts. By choosing this option, you can enjoy a beautiful landscape while being mindful of water usage and sustainability.
When selecting grasses for a drought-resistant lawn in Rochester, consider native and adaptive varieties that are well-suited to the local climate. Fine fescue, for example, is a drought-tolerant grass that requires less water and can thrive in shaded areas. Kentucky bluegrass is another option that, while more water-dependent, can be mixed with drought-resistant varieties for a balanced lawn. Additionally, consider using buffalo grass, which is known for its resilience and low water requirements. Consulting with local landscaping experts can help you choose the right combination of grasses that will create a lush, drought-resistant lawn tailored to your Rochester home.
